Word: Atheroma
Speech Type: Noun
Etymology:
late 16th century: via Latin from Greek athērōma, from athērē, atharē ‘groats’
Audio Pronunciation:
Phonetic Spelling:
ˌaθəˈrəʊmə
Dialects: British English
Definition:
degeneration of the walls of the arteries caused by accumulated fatty deposits and scar tissue, and leading to restriction of the circulation and a risk of thrombosis.
